My point is we did something that actually worked, we got two free run to the QB, then we didn't go back to it, but maybe once, Queen shot through and made a nice tackle for loss. Why? because it's a bit of a gamble and Tomlin doesn't like it, he'd rather play it safe and conservative. Teams rarely doubled Harrison back in 07-10 because if they did, LeBeau would send a blitz from anywhere at anytime.
